Abstract
The present invention relates to a kind of active lower axle rotary hoisting tools, including crossbeam one, crossbeam two, suspension hook, motor is housed on the crossbeam one, the output end of motor assembles rack gear, tooth set is equipped in gear ring, tooth set is fixedly connected with crossbeam two by axis pin, be symmetrically installed on institute's crossbeam one there are two hydraulic cylinder, the end of hydraulic cylinder is connected with crossbeam two, the crossbeam one, crossbeam two both sides be arranged with suspension hook.Tooling in the present invention uses combined type shoulder pole girder construction, crossbeam one and the accurate rotational positioning within the scope of 360 degree of crossbeam two, there are multiple hanging points on crossbeam one and crossbeam two simultaneously, can meet the needs of multi-point suspended, it solves the problems, such as Hoisting Position, solves the problems, such as that weight is big, the center of gravity of the big equipment of volume confirms, safety coefficient can be improved, working efficiency is improved, working strength is reduced.

Background technology
Existing large piece lifting generally sets up auxiliary mould by shoulder pole girder or on the ground and carries out, shoulder pole girder suspension
On travelling crane hook, then hanging piece is hung on shoulder pole girder, needs to carry out the adjustment in orientation during equipment installation or removal
When, it can only be moved integrally and be completed by the rising and driving for hook of driving a vehicle, error is larger, needs need when subtle angle adjustment
It wants ground staff to carry out oblique pull auxiliary using jack to complete, inefficiency, and there are larger security risks.
Especially when large scale equipment is installed, it is sometimes desirable to carry out precise fine-adjustment external form to height and orientation and irregularly lift
When, it needs multi-point suspended, original single shoulder pole girder and hoisting fixture that cannot meet above-mentioned requirements, needs manpower to carry out a large amount of
Back work causes working efficiency low, and the uncontrollable factor of secure context is more, increases security risk;In order to find equipment
Lifting equalization point, need repeatedly to lift by crane verification, eventually find equalization point, in this way, working efficiency is low, more people is needed to coordinate,
When other equipment is arranged at top, needs oblique pull, tiltedly hangs, since the weight of equipment is big, volume is big, the uncontrollable factor of secure context
It is more, increase security risk.

Specific implementation mode
In conjunction with the accompanying drawings, the present invention is further explained in detail.
A kind of active lower axle rotary hoisting tool according to figure 1, including crossbeam 1, crossbeam 24, suspension hook 5, institute
It states and motor 2 is housed on crossbeam 1, the output end of motor 2 assembles rack gear 6, and tooth set is equipped in gear ring 6, and tooth set and crossbeam 24 are logical
It crosses axis pin to be fixedly connected, be symmetrically installed on institute's crossbeam 1 there are two hydraulic cylinder 3, the end of hydraulic cylinder 3 is connected with crossbeam 24, institute
State crossbeam 1, the both sides of crossbeam 24 are arranged with suspension hook 5.
Specifically, the motor is assemblied in the centre of crossbeam 1, and tooth set is fixed on the centre of crossbeam 24.
Specifically, the crossbeam 1, crossbeam 24 are equipped with multiple suspension hooks 5.
Two hydraulic cylinders 3 that the both sides of crossbeam 1 are symmetrically installed mainly play load to crossbeam 24 and movement are flat
The effect of weighing apparatus is conducive to equipment and keeps stablizing during slinging using the feature that hydraulic drive is steady;Hydraulic cylinder 3 is stretched
Contracting can make the gear on motor 2 complete to engage and be detached from the tooth set in gear ring 6, when in meshing state, the rotation of motor 2
Turn that 24 common rotation of crossbeam 1 and crossbeam may be implemented, it can be achieved that upper beam 24 is with respect to crossbeam one when in disengaged position
1 rotation achievees the purpose that crossbeam 1 and crossbeam 24 have angle, specific angle can be according to the suspension centre of hanging device in this way
It is determined with center of gravity.
The suspension hook that multiple and different positions can be arranged in crossbeam 1 and crossbeam 24 is suspension centre, can meet different volumes and outer
Type is irregular, the equipment of the bad confirmation of center of gravity, can avoid the length solution for repeatedly adjusting steel wire rope by adjusting the position of suspension centre
Certainly problems improve working efficiency, reduce working strength.
